/ Forside / Teknologi / Udvikling / PHP /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
PHP
#NavnPoint
rfh 3959
natmaden 3372
poul_from 3310
funbreak 2700
stone47 2230
Jin2k 1960
Angband 1743
Bjerner 1249
refi 1185
10  Interkril.. 1146
Autodate med phpmyadmin
Fra : Nederbasse


Dato : 13-02-05 16:29

Hej

Er der ikke noget med at man kan sætte en dato ind i en mysql tabel med
phpmyadmin ?
Altså noget med datatype= DATE og VAlue? NOW() eller CURRDATE , jeg har
prøvet med forskelligt men ianset havd jeg skriver kommer der 000 i tabellen

Lars



 
 
Mads Sülau Jørgensen (13-02-2005)
Kommentar
Fra : Mads Sülau Jørgensen


Dato : 13-02-05 17:23

Nederbasse wrote:

> Er der ikke noget med at man kan sætte en dato ind i en mysql tabel med
> phpmyadmin ?

Det har ikke noget med php eller phpmyadmin at gøre, det er ren SQL.

> Altså noget med datatype= DATE og VAlue? NOW() eller CURRDATE , jeg har
> prøvet med forskelligt men ianset havd jeg skriver kommer der 000 i tabellen

Men det kan gøres som så:

INSERT INTO tabel(felt1, datofelt) VALUES ('streng', NOW());

Det vil så indsætte en række i tabel med følgende værdier:

felt: 'streng'
datofelt: fx. 2005-01-01 00:00:00 hvis det nu var nytårsaften :)

--
Mads Sülau Jørgensen
"All glory to the hypno toad"

Nederbasse (13-02-2005)
Kommentar
Fra : Nederbasse


Dato : 13-02-05 17:58

>
> Det har ikke noget med php eller phpmyadmin at gøre, det er ren SQL.
>
>> Altså noget med datatype= DATE og VAlue? NOW() eller CURRDATE , jeg har
>> prøvet med forskelligt men ianset havd jeg skriver kommer der 000 i
>> tabellen
>
> Men det kan gøres som så:
>
> INSERT INTO tabel(felt1, datofelt) VALUES ('streng', NOW());
>
> Det vil så indsætte en række i tabel med følgende værdier:
>
> felt: 'streng'
> datofelt: fx. 2005-01-01 00:00:00 hvis det nu var nytårsaften :)
>
> --
> Mads Sülau Jørgensen
> "All glory to the hypno toad"

Ved godt det har med mysql at gøre men hvis der lige var en nem løsning i
stedet for at skulle rette i php koden
Jeg mener jeg har lavet det i phpmyadmin engang men er ikke helt sikker

Lars



Troels Hansen (14-02-2005)
Kommentar
Fra : Troels Hansen


Dato : 14-02-05 10:26

Nederbasse wrote:

> Ved godt det har med mysql at gøre men hvis der lige var en nem løsning i
> stedet for at skulle rette i php koden
> Jeg mener jeg har lavet det i phpmyadmin engang men er ikke helt sikker
>
> Lars

phpmyadmin kan ikke gøre noget ved databasen som du ikke kan gøre i ren sql.
Sæt din default value til now() og pas så ellers på når du laver en
update på en række, da dette vil resultere i at feltet vil opdatere til
den nuværende dato, medmindre du sætter feltet=feltet når du laver updaten.


Søg
Reklame
Statistik
Spørgsmål : 177560
Tips : 31968
Nyheder : 719565
Indlæg : 6408941
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ste